Interface IDirectorySearch (iads.h)
L’interface IDirectorySearch est une interface COM pure qui fournit une méthode à faible surcharge que les clients non-Automation peuvent utiliser pour effectuer des requêtes dans le répertoire sous-jacent.
Parmi les fournisseurs ADSI fournis par le système, seul le fournisseur LDAP prend en charge cette interface.
L’interface IDirectorySearch hérite de l’interface IUnknown. IDirectorySearch possède également les types de membres suivants :
L’interface IDirectorySearch contient ces méthodes.
IDirectorySearch::AbandonSearch La méthode IDirectorySearch::AbandonSearch abandonne une recherche lancée par un appel antérieur à la méthode ExecuteSearch. |
IDirectorySearch::CloseSearchHandle La méthode IDirectorySearch::CloseSearchHandle ferme le handle à un résultat de recherche et libère la mémoire associée. |
IDirectorySearch::ExecuteSearch La méthode IDirectorySearch::ExecuteSearch exécute une recherche et transmet les résultats à l’appelant. |
IDirectorySearch::FreeColumn La méthode IDirectorySearch::FreeColumn libère la mémoire que la méthode IDirectorySearch::GetColumn allouée pour les données de la colonne. |
IDirectorySearch::GetColumn La méthode IDirectorySearch::GetColumn obtient des données à partir d’une colonne nommée du résultat de la recherche. |
IDirectorySearch::GetFirstRow La méthode GetFirstRow obtient la première ligne d’un résultat de recherche. Cette méthode génère ou réédite une nouvelle recherche, même si cette méthode a déjà été appelée. |
IDirectorySearch::GetNextColumnName La méthode IDirectorySearch::GetNextColumnName obtient le nom de la colonne suivante dans le résultat de recherche qui contient des données. |
IDirectorySearch::GetNextRow Obtient la ligne suivante du résultat de recherche. |
IDirectorySearch::GetPreviousRow La méthode IDirectorySearch::GetPreviousRow obtient la ligne précédente du résultat de la recherche. Si le fournisseur ne prend pas en charge les curseurs, il doit retourner E_NOTIMPL. |
IDirectorySearch::SetSearchPreference Spécifie une préférence de recherche pour obtenir des données dans une recherche ultérieure. |
Client minimal pris en charge | Windows Vista |
Serveur minimal pris en charge | Windows Server 2008 |
Plateforme cible | Windows |
En-tête | iads.h |